Lilian Cheung is a scholar working on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, General Health Professions and Pharmacy. According to data from OpenAlex, Lilian Cheung has authored 19 papers receiving a total of 1.2k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 12 papers in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, 6 papers in General Health Professions and 6 papers in Pharmacy. Recurrent topics in Lilian Cheung’s work include Obesity, Physical Activity, Diet (12 papers), Obesity and Health Practices (6 papers) and Food Security and Health in Diverse Populations (4 papers). Lilian Cheung is often cited by papers focused on Obesity, Physical Activity, Diet (12 papers), Obesity and Health Practices (6 papers) and Food Security and Health in Diverse Populations (4 papers). Lilian Cheung collaborates with scholars based in United States. Lilian Cheung's co-authors include Steven L. Gortmaker, Graham A. Colditz, David B. Herzog, William H. Dietz, Ellice Lieberman, Virginia R. Chomitz, Anne Wolf, Alison E. Field, Alison E. Field and Cindy W. Leung and has published in prestigious journals such as PEDIATRICS, American Journal of Public Health and Annals of the New York Academy of Sciences.
